Para quem não pode assistir a transmissão do Lazarus Streaming Day, disponibilizamos no youtube.
Total de 41 vídeos na playlist FREE !!
Assista a Playlist, clique aqui
Meu dia-a-dia tecnológico
Para quem não pode assistir a transmissão do Lazarus Streaming Day, disponibilizamos no youtube.
Total de 41 vídeos na playlist FREE !!
Assista a Playlist, clique aqui
Todo mundo sabe que alguns quarentões do Delphi ou Lazarus defende com
unhas e dentes a produtividade desta maravilhosa ferramenta. Eu também
faço parte deste grupo.
Mas resolvi me aventurar e conhecer um pouco
mais sobre como programar em Java. Este vídeo mostra minha primeira
experiência, vai servir para dinossauros como eu fazer algumas
comparações entre as linguagens !
Neste primeiro vídeo vamos criar um projeto em Lazarus/Delphi e outro no Java.
Vamos usar botões, variáveis e trabalhar com operador IF/ELSE.
Lazarus é um ambiente de desenvolvimento integrado desenvolvido para o
compilador Free Pascal. O software é compatível com o Delphi e, ao mesmo
tempo, suporta diversas arquiteturas e sistemas operacionais como
Windows, Linux e MAC OS X.
Nesta vídeo-aula vamos aprender a criar uma Agenda utilizando base de Firebird e componentes nativos do Lazarus (SQLTransaction, SQLConnection, SQLQuery e DataSource).
Para instalar o Firebird no Ubuntu, assista a vídeo aula, CLIQUE AQUI.
Script para criação da tabela, procedimento e gatilho logo abaixo do vídeo:
Script para Criar tabela:
p { margin-bottom: 0.25cm; line-height: 120%; }
CREATE TABLE
CLIENTES(CODIGO integer NOT
NULL,NOME varchar(50),ENDERECO
varchar(50),BAIRRO
varchar(30),CIDADE
varchar(50),UF varchar(2),CEP varchar(10),TELEFONE
varchar(15),CONSTRAINT
PK_CLIENTE PRIMARY KEY (CODIGO),CONSTRAINT UK_NOME
UNIQUE (NOME)USING INDEX
IX_NOME);
p { margin-bottom: 0.25cm; line-height: 120%; }CREATE GENERATOR
CODCLI_GEN;
Script para Criar Trigger (Gatilho):
p { margin-bottom: 0.25cm; line-height: 120%; }
SET TERM ^ ;CREATE TRIGGER
CODCLI FOR CLIENTES ACTIVEBEFORE INSERT
POSITION 3ASBEGINnew.CODIGO =
gen_id( CODCLI_GEN, 1 );
END^SET TERM ; ^
Aṕos o término da vídeo aula, percebi um erro quando editamos o registro.
Fiz outro vídeo para resolver o seguinte erro: “No update query specified and failed to generate one”
Lazarus é um ambiente de desenvolvimento integrado desenvolvido para o
compilador Free Pascal. O software é compatível com o Delphi e, ao mesmo
tempo, suporta diversas arquiteturas e sistemas operacionais como
Windows, Linux e MAC OS X.
Nesta vídeo-aula vamos aprender a criar e utilizar funções e procedimentos. Vamos criar uma função onde você passa como parâmetro o preço de custo de um produto e o Lucro e o calculo do preço de venda é retornado pela função.
Outro exemplo de função é o inverso da função acima, onde passamos o valor de custo e o valor de venda, a função retorna o a margem de lucro bruto.
Lazarus é um ambiente de desenvolvimento integrado desenvolvido para o
compilador Free Pascal. O software é compatível com o Delphi e, ao mesmo
tempo, suporta diversas arquiteturas e sistemas operacionais como
Windows, Linux e MAC OS X.
Nesta vídeo aula vamos aprender a trabalhar com “if, then, case, while e for.”
Lazarus é um ambiente de desenvolvimento integrado desenvolvido para o compilador Free Pascal. O software é compatível com o Delphi e, ao mesmo tempo, suporta diversas arquiteturas e sistemas operacionais como Windows, Linux e MAC OS X.
Hoje vamos aprender a declarar variáveis do tipo time (hora), subtrair horas, encontrar tempo, usar o comando InputQuery para capturar variáveis e validar as mesmas. Entender o IF, ELSE IF e ELSE.
Lazarus é um ambiente de desenvolvimento integrado desenvolvido para o compilador Free Pascal. O software é compatível com o Delphi e, ao mesmo tempo, suporta diversas arquiteturas e sistemas operacionais como Windows, Linux e MAC OS X.
Hoje vamos entender operadores, declarar variáveis numéricas e datas, somar variáveis, transformar em outro tipo de dados, obter quantidade de anos e dias entre duas datas, exibir resultados em campo memo.